Inception Meeting on Research on Community-Based Paralegals in Africa

The Socio-Economic Rights Project at the Dullah Omar Institute, University of the Western Cape, in conjunction with the African Centre of Excellence for Access to Justice (ACE-AJ) hosted an inception workshop on the second phase of the research from 5-6 April 2022 in Entebbe, Uganda.

The objective of the workshop was to share some thoughts on research plans, participants and methodology that will be used for the second phase of the study. The second phase of the research will be conducted in three selected Francophone countries from West and Central Africa- Cameroon, Cote d’Ivoire and Senegal. The inception workshop has brought together stakeholders from across Africa including members of the African Centre of Excellence for Access to Justice, representatives from civil society organizations, community-based organizations, non-governmental organizations, regional bodies/institutions, policy makers, human rights advocates, and academics to engage in a fruitful discussion on the challenges of access to justice in Africa.
